The CNB-80 and CNB-120

BORIDE Engineered Abrasives has specially fabricated advanced composites with proprietary fiber to create our newest product, the CNB-120. Through extensive product testing with the CNB-80, the CNB-120 has evolved to become one of the thinnest, strongest and most aggressive polishing products on the market today.

How is it used?

Consider the CNB-120 a fiber partner to the Ceramic Stone family; and it is used much the same way. The cutting action of the CNB-120 is at the tip and sides.
The CNB-120 is a coarse fiber and is associated to an approximate 120 grit stone. The CNB- 120 can be used by hand or with short stroke profilers such as the TLL- 07 Turbo-Lap.

At .8 mm thick with widths of 4, 6 and 10mm and lengths of 75mm (3”) and 150mm (6”) in the 10mm only, the CNB- 120 is an excellent rough-in tool on ribs and slots. Cutter marks and EDM scale on any material are no match for the CNB-120. The CNB- 120 can be used with or without lubricant.
